• Robots are seen on T.V. (Star Trek - The Next Generation) and in the movies (The Day the Earth Stood Still, Forbidden Planet, Lost in Space, Blade Runner, Star Wars).

• These imaginary robots do a lot of things that the real ones can not do.

• Some robots in movies, video and computer games are made to attack people.

What did we learn?What did we learn?

• Many types of robots exist.• Progress of technology allows now to build an Intelligent

Robot with Perception and Manipulation under $1000.• There are several kits for high school robotics.• Robotics allows to explain ideas of control, software,

sensors, motors and other effectors, image processing, pattern recognition, machine learning and Artificial Intelligence

• Small robot that you can build in a classroom can explain all important principles at a fraction of cost

• You are no longer restricted to robotic arms, kits allow to build any type of robot.
